MPower is a climate and fintech startup with proven long-term experience. It provides small and medium-sized solar energy infrastructures in developing countries. With a B2B model that combines hardware, software, and financing solutions, it transforms accessibility and impact into profitability.
Patrick Biber and his team at eConnect provide technical training and capacity building for local technicians and hub managers.
Description
The project aims to set up five EnergyHubs each in Ghana, Cameroon, and Togo by combining the electrification of social infrastructure with productive use services that improve livelihoods.
The EnergyHubs are easily deployable solar systems – of 10 kWp capacity – that act as business hubs providing free electricity to health centers/schools while offering income-generating services e.g., hair cutting, welding, photocopying, cooling & freezing compartments, sales of solar products, rental of batteries with light or phone charging.
Each Hub will be operated by a Hub Manager and Assistant employed by MPower, creating 2 direct jobs in each 15 Hubs. In addition, each Hub typically generates 4 new local jobs for entrepreneurs running the above-mentioned services.
